Math Sense: Decimals, Fractions, Ratios, and Percents.
Frechette, Ellen Carley
This book is designed to help adults gain the range of math skills they need to succeed in life and work and on standardized tests including the GED. It is expected to help students overcome math anxiety, discover math as interesting and purposeful, and develop good number sense. Lessons are organized around four strands: (1) skill lessons presenting instruction and practice in math skills including computation and solving word problems; (2) tools lessons emphasizing the use of objects such as calculators or concepts such as estimation, all within real life contexts; (3) problem solving lessons that strengthen estimation and reasoning skills and help students build strategies for solving single and multi-step problems; and (4) application lessons that provide practice with realistic situations that require mathematics.
